    cebit preparation: ASUS CUII @ 1625 3D03 + 1600 3D06

    Testing hardware for cebit...

    With the CUs here I felt like in the MTV-show NEXT...



    Also got my new GPU-container yesterday:





    Temps where -180°C ~ -185°C:

    vGPU = 1,58 V
    vDIMM = 1,85 V
    vPLL = 1,27 V (maybe less possible)





    Thanx to Christian, Marcus and Jon for their support!

    Will also bench with R3E BLACK EDITION on cebit...
